Real estate sales in Nuremberg: Why clarity in the process retains buyers

A real estate sale rarely fails due to a lack of interest, but often due to a lack of clarity in the process. Buyers want to know where they stand, what steps follow and what their expectations are. Unclear processes lead to uncertainty, delays and ultimately to buyers leaving the market. In Nuremberg, where buyers make structured comparisons and conscious decisions, process clarity is a decisive factor for sales success.

Buyers expect guidance

Buyers don’t want to be left guessing how the sales process will work. If you communicate clearly from the outset how viewings are organized, how offers are submitted and what the time frame is, you take uncertainty out of the decision-making process.

Unclear processes create mistrust

If steps are changed spontaneously, deadlines are unclear or information is only provided on request, this creates the impression of a lack of control. Buyers wonder whether legal or organizational issues are also unclear. This mistrust has a direct impact on the willingness to buy.

Clearly defined phases create security

A transparent process with clear phases - information, viewing, offer, inspection, completion - makes it easier for buyers to find their way around. They know where they stand and what comes next. This security promotes commitment.

Clear rules for offers

Buyers want to know how offers are handled. Is there a fixed time period? Do you talk to several interested parties? Unclear rules lead to restraint or tactical behavior. Clear rules encourage serious offers.

Time planning reduces pressure

A transparent time frame helps buyers to plan their financing and decisions. If this planning is missing, unnecessary pressure or delays arise. Both have a negative impact on the sales process.

Communication as part of the process

Process clarity is not only created through structure, but also through regular communication. Buyers want to know whether they are being considered and when they can expect feedback. Silence is often interpreted as rejection or uncertainty.

Clear responsibilities create trust

Buyers need to know who the contact person is and who makes decisions. Changing responsibilities or contradictory statements come across as unprofessional and unsettling. Clear responsibilities strengthen trust.

Process clarity filters suitable buyers

A clear process deters non-binding interested parties and attracts serious buyers. Those who are prepared to engage in a structured process are more willing to close the deal.

Clarity protects against renegotiation

Many renegotiations occur because expectations were not clearly defined. A transparent process with clear framework conditions reduces room for interpretation and protects the agreed price.

Structure replaces pressure

A clear process creates commitment without pressure. Buyers feel guided, not pressured. This significantly increases the likelihood of closing the deal.

Successful real estate sales in Nuremberg with clear processes

Anyone selling a property in Nuremberg should give the sales process a clear structure. Transparent processes, clear communication and reliable steps create security, retain buyers and are crucial for a secure, economically successful sale.
